We are looking for an electronics engineering student assistant to help our R&D electronics team in their daily work.

The position is 7-15 hours a week (flexible during exam & vacation periods) and the location is at our headquarter in Farum (10-15 minutes walk from the station).


The Job

As our new Electronics Student Assistant, you’ll support the R&D Electronics team with hands-on tasks that keep prototypes, lab equipment, and our workspace running smoothly, with tasks like:

  • Soldering & rework – through-hole and SMD on prototypes and boards
  • Cable & harness assembly – crimping, routing, labelling
  • Lab testing – take basic measurements with oscilloscopes or multimeters
  • Documentation – handle small documentation tasks
  • Ad-hoc electronics support – assist colleagues with troubleshooting and other hands-on tasks that pop up
  • Future growth opportunity – if you’re up for it, you can later take on small PCB layout jobs for test rigs and fixtures.

You will collaborate closely with hardware, software and mechanical engineers but will also get plenty of independent “own-it” tasks.

About MagVenture

MagVenture is a pioneering Danish medtech company and global leader in magnetic stimulation therapy. As result of FDA-approval and scientific studies, our cutting-edge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) technology is now transforming the treatment of complex conditions such as depression, OCD, and neurological disorders like Parkinson’s, dementia, and PTSD.

With more than 200 dedicated employees globally – and growing fast – we offer you a unique opportunity to work at the forefront of innovation in medical technology. All product development and manufacturing take place in-house at our headquarters near Copenhagen (Farum), ensuring seamless collaboration across disciplines.
